I got mine via leasebusters.com and also through someone on the forums who referred me to the seller. Initially I visited some used cards dealerships but wasn't impressed with what they had to offer.
I too had the same requirements as you. I was generally weary of private dealerships. I found that most of the time, they would be US cars that were imported and being sold here. Or they would have unusually low odometers. One even advertised the odometer in KM, when it was actually in Miles. So after that I only looked at leasebusters, and BMW dealerships. I did my lease transfer via BMW Mississauga. If found that I saved a good amount if I took over someones lease. Once it goes back to a dealer, they add a bunch of overhead, that you will need to bargain off. Happy hunting! |

Our cars, especially the Vert's. are usually discounted heavily around christmas and the new year. If you don't mind holding off a bit you can get a really good deal.
Btw, don't make the same mistake I made when I bought lol. Get LCI version 2009+. They come stock with beautiful AE's (xenon package) and the rear lights are also nicer and upgradeable. (Reverse lights). I'm sure there are other positives, but can't think of it right now lol... Enjoy and GL |
